How To Fix RSBPC0_EXCEPTION222 - Start schedule &1(&2)


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: RSBPC0_EXCEPTION - Basic Exception Messages

  • Message number: 222

  • Message text: Start schedule &1(&2)

    The SAP error message RSBPC0_EXCEPTION222 Start schedule &1(&2) typically occurs in the context of SAP Business Planning and Consolidation (BPC) when there is an issue with starting a scheduled job or process. This error can arise due to various reasons, including configuration issues, data inconsistencies, or system resource limitations.

    Possible Causes:

    1. Configuration Issues: The job or process may not be configured correctly in the BPC system.
    2. Data Issues: There may be inconsistencies or errors in the data that the job is trying to process.
    3. Resource Limitations: The system may be running low on resources (e.g., memory, CPU) which can prevent the job from starting.
    4. Authorization Issues: The user or process may not have the necessary permissions to start the scheduled job.
    5. System Errors: There could be underlying system errors or issues with the SAP environment that are preventing the job from executing.

    Solutions:

    1. Check Job Configuration: Review the configuration of the scheduled job to ensure that all parameters are set correctly.
    2. Review Logs: Check the application logs and job logs for more detailed error messages that can provide insights into what went wrong.
    3. Data Validation: Validate the data being processed to ensure there are no inconsistencies or errors that could be causing the job to fail.
    4. Resource Monitoring: Monitor system resources to ensure that there are sufficient resources available for the job to run. If necessary, optimize system performance or schedule jobs during off-peak hours.
    5. Authorization Check: Ensure that the user or process has the necessary authorizations to execute the job.
    6. Consult SAP Notes: Look for relevant SAP Notes or documentation that may address this specific error message or provide additional troubleshooting steps.
    7. Contact SAP Support: If the issue persists, consider reaching out to SAP Support for further assistance.

    Related Information:

    • Transaction Codes: Familiarize yourself with relevant transaction codes such as SM37 (Job Monitoring) to check the status of scheduled jobs.
